Abortion, civil unions, euthanasia: Vannacci‘s positions are radical and well defined in the Futuro Nazionale program ahead of the upcoming elections. Abortion is not a right, enough gays on TV, civil unions to be canceled and military education in schools. But is it really a winning program? This is discussed on 4 di Sera, an in-depth program on Rete4 where the guest of the moment is Antonio Caprarica, journalist and writer, former Rai correspondent for years.

Caprarica flinches in front of these so reactionary ideas, largely thought out and written by Lorenzo Gasperini, philosophy professor, 34 years old, former city councilor of the Lega in Cecina and today the deus ex-machina of the general: “The wave of indignation in front of this testimony of the Middle Ages that resurfaces unfortunately shows how instrumental and useless the heated controversy a few days ago by the Five Star leader, Giuseppe Conte, on woke, the battle against the excesses of woke culture, cancel culture, that is political correctness. But this may perhaps be a problem concerning some American universities, not our country. These Middle Ages relapses, the denial of rights, the rejection of these rights, unfortunately still manage to gain, according to polls, mass consensus, which demonstrates the need to maintain alongside the battle against inequalities, the battle for rights.”
“What we are facing – continues Caprarica – is not even the battle cry of Bossi and secession was, after all, a purely political choice. Here we are beyond that, the Vannacci dictum is a violation of the basic principles of our Constitution. Any political party that agrees to engage with this movement, well, would do well to think about it, because it is truly breaking the firewall of democratic guarantees that we should all erect against movements like Vannacci’s.”
